The Canadore College Board of Governors has received the long waited for report on workplace culture at the college.

Last night, president George Burton issued a similar refrain that was sent out in a press release last week that the report was being reviewed and more will be said in due course.

“We’ll have more to say on the report, the effects of the report when the board has had time to digest the report and there will be a comment coming from the college,” he says.

He wouldn’t give a timeline on when that’ll be.

“We want to give the board time to digest the report and comment accordingly. We’re not being vague to be vague. We want to ensure we follow due process which we’ve been standing hard behind since this event unfolded,” Burton says.

He was asked if OPSEU will get to see the report. He said the college will respond to the union when the board has had time to digest the report.
